Bugcrowd has announced its May 2016 Hall of Fame winners, recognizing top performers who earned significant points through last-minute submissions. The top winner, mert, received a $2,500 bonus for topping the leaderboard with 786 points. Other researchers who will receive bonuses include hydrantlabs and Harie_cool, although their exact point totals are not specified. To excel in Bugcrowd, submitting high-severity bugs that result in critical security impacts can lead to bigger rewards and faster invitations to private bounty programs.
